Artist Interview: Ralph Pezzullo

Artist Interview: Ralph Pezzullo

Tell us about yourself and your music


I’ve been playing music for a while. I started as a teenager in Bogota, Colombia where I was a member of the seminal band Wallflower Complexion. Since then I’ve continued playing music while raising a family and writing bestselling books. Recently, I’ve been performing and writing music. I feel as though I’ve found my voice as a songwriter.


Talk to us more about your latest release


I’ve recently released the first series of five songs. I’m featuring Surrender To – a song I’m particularly proud of which I feel is funky and personal at the same time. It gets a great reaction when played live.


 



 


What inspired you to write this release?


It just sort of came to me one night as I was playing around with my guitar. It captures what I was feeling at the time.
